HerokuApp

The Internet Herokuapp is a web application designed for practicing functional testing and test automation across a variety of common web application scenarios. The project's objective was to validate critical functionalities such as authentication, dynamic elements, file uploads, alerts, tables, forms, and navigation through automated testing. An automation framework was developed following industry best practices to ensure maintainability, reusability, and scalability of the test scripts. As a result, regression testing became more efficient, functional test coverage was increased, and defects were identified earlier in the development cycle.
